Hell: A Cyberpunk Thriller Take-Two Interactive Software, Inc. / GameTek, Inc. 1994

The first game from Take 2 is a fun cyberpunk-meets-Inferno romp with an interesting plot: in the future where Hell is proven to exist and demons have real jobs, you play a police couple Gideon and Rachel who inexplicably become wanted criminals overnight. You must find out why you've been betrayed, and by whom. Dennis Hopper's voice is the only high-point of voice acting in this game, and most dialogues go on forever. Still, the game is recommended for some good (tough) puzzles and truly epic length, with multiple solutions and optional sub-plots. It uses a simple point-and-click interface. You advance in the game by talking to people and manipulating objects to solve puzzles. The game utilizes pre-rendered backgrounds and FMV sequences as cut-scenes.
